A Notice of Termination is a formal written document used by one party to notify another that a contract, agreement, or employment relationship will be ending as of a specified date. Its fundamental purpose is to provide clear, official communication of the intention to terminate, allowing both parties to prepare for and comply with the ending of the agreement. This notice ensures legal clarity, helps avoid misunderstandings or disputes, and often fulfills contractual or statutory obligations regarding advance notice.
The Notice of Termination is commonly used in employment contexts, landlord-tenant arrangements, service contracts, and other business agreements. For employers, it officially informs employees that their employment will end, stating reasons (if required), the effective date, and any relevant post-termination obligations or benefits. In lease agreements, it notifies tenants or landlords of the intention to end the tenancy under agreed timelines. The notice can also be involved in ending other contracts, specifying terms such as final payments and obligations.
